Detail of > 93-14-1
- MSDS Download

- CAS Number:
- 93-14-1
- Name:
Guaifenesin
- Formula:
- C10H14O4
- Molecular Structure:

- Synonyms:
- 1,2-Propanediol,3-(o-methoxyphenoxy)- (6CI,8CI);1,2-Dihydroxy-3-(2-methoxyphenoxy)propane;2-G;3-(2-Methoxyphenoxy)-1,2-propanediol;3-(o-Methoxyphenoxy)-1,2-propanediol;Actifed C;Aeronesin;Amonidren;Aresol;Calmipan;Colrex Expectorant;Creson;Dilyn;Equicol;Glycerin guaiacolate;Glycerol guaiacolate;Glycerol a-(2-methoxyphenyl)ether;Glycerol a-(o-methoxyphenyl)ether;Glycerol a-guaiacyl ether;Glyceryl guaiacolether;Glyceryl guaiacolate;Glyceryl guaiacolate ether;Glyceryl guaiacylether;Glycerylguaiacol;Glycodex;Glycotuss;Guaiacol glycerin ether;Guaiacolglycerol ether;Guaiacol glyceryl ether;Guaiacuran;Guaiacurane;Guaiacylglyceryl ether;Guaiamar;Guaianesin;
- Molecular Weight:
- 198.24
- EINECS:
- 202-222-5
- Density:
- 1.195 g/cm3
- Melting Point:
- 77-81 °C
- Boiling Point:
- 356.8 °C at 760 mmHg
- Flash Point:
- 169.6 °C
- Solubility:
- 5 g/100 mL (25 °C) in water
- Appearance:
- White Solid
- Hazard Symbols:
Xn- Risk Codes:
- 22-36/37/38
- Safety:
- 26-36Details
- Deleted CAS:
- 1336-67-0|128707-44-8|12041-73-5

- Quantitative determinations of codeine phosphate, guaifenesin, pheniramine maleate, phenylpropanolamine hydrochloride, and pyrilamine maleate in an expectorant by high-pressure liquid chromatography. Das Gupta, V.; Ghanekar, A. G. (Coll. Pharm., Univ. Houston, Houston, Tex., USA). J. Pharm. Sci., 66(6), 895-7 (English) 1977. CODEN: JPMSAE. DOCUMENT TYPE: Journal CA Section: 64 (Pharmaceutical Analysis) The quant. detns. of codeine phosphate (I) [52-28-8], guaifenesin [93-14-1], pheniramine maleate [132-20-7], phenylpropanolamine-HCl [154-41-6], and pyrilamine maleate [59-33-6] in a liq. dosage form are described. All active and inactive ingredients (Na benzoate and FD&C Yellow No. 5 dye) can be sepd. with high-pressure liq. chromatog. on a monomol. layer of octadecyltrichlorosilane bonded to Si-C using 0.05M KH2PO4 in water contg. 13% (vol./vol.) MeOH as the solvent except the 2 antihistamines, pheniramine maleate and pyrilamine maleate. Pheniramine maleate is detd. either by difference or spectrophotometrically. The methods are simple, short, accurate, and precise. The std. deviations are reported.

- A gas chromatographic method for the quantitative determination of glyceryl guaiacolate, methyl-p-hydroxybenzoate and propyl-p-hydroxybenzoate in cough mixture. Jensen, Fred (Nor. Apot. Forsoekslab., Oslo, Norway). Medd. Nor. Farm. Selsk., 39(1), 38-48 (English) 1977. CODEN: MNFSAW. DOCUMENT TYPE: Journal CA Section: 64 (Pharmaceutical Analysis) Simultaneous quant. detn. of glyceryl guaiacolate (I) [93-14-1], Me p-hydroxybenzoate (II; R=Me) [99-76-3] and Pr p-hydroxybenzoate (II; R=Pr) [94-13-3] in cough mixts. was carried out, after extn. with CHCl3, by derivatization with trimethylchlorosilane and hexamethyldisilazane, and subsequent gas chromatog. of the silyl derivs. on a column of 3% OV-1 on Gas-Chrom Q (60-80 mesh). Relative std. deviations were 1-2%. Of some possible degrdn. products tested, none interfered with the method.
